Silicone textile printing inks are a type of ink specifically developed for screen printing on textiles. They are composed of a mixture of silicone polymers and various pigments, additives, and fillers to achieve the desired printing properties.

The major advantage of silicone textile printing inks is their high elasticity and excellent adhesion to a variety of fabrics, including cotton, polyester, nylon, and blends. This makes them ideal for printing on stretchable, waterproof, or heat-sensitive fabrics such as athletic wear, swimwear, and umbrellas. Additionally, silicone inks have high resistance to abrasion, washing, and heat, which results in long-lasting prints.

To use silicone textile printing inks, the water-proof fabric first needs to be pre-treated with a special primer or coating that promotes adhesion and prevents ink migration. The ink is then applied to the fabric surface using a screen printing press or manual screen printing technique. The ink should be applied in thin, even layers with a squeegee to avoid clogging or smudging. The prints are then cured at high temperatures (between 300-400°F) through either heat transfer or oven-curing methods to achieve full bonding and durability.If it's cotton blender or normal nylon,polyester,you can print silicone ink on them without printing primer.

Silicone textile printing inks consist of a polymer base, usually a combination of polydimethylsiloxane (PDMS) and other silicone copolymers. PDMS is a highly elastic, heat-resistant, and non-toxic material that has excellent adhesion to various surfaces, including textile fabrics. Other additives such as pigments, fillers, and thickeners are then incorporated to give the ink its desired color, texture, and printing properties.

In addition to their physical properties, silicone textile printing inks are also free from harmful chemicals such as formaldehyde, heavy metals, and volatile organic compounds (VOCs). This makes them a healthier and safer choice for both the environment and the workers handling them.
